Familia Michoacana

The Familia Michoacana is a once-powerful cartel whose influence drained after the death of its leader in 2014.

Key Actors

Servando Gomez Martinez, alias 'La Tuta'

MEXICO / 2017-03-09

Servando Gomez Martinez, alias "La Tuta," was a former high-ranking member of the Familia Michoacana.

José Jesús Méndez Vargas, alias 'El Chango'

MEXICO / 2017-03-10

Jose Jesus Mendez Vargas, alias "El Chango," was the right hand man of the leader of the Familia Michoacana.

Nazario Moreno Gonzalez, alias 'El Chayo'

MEXICO / JULY 24, 2019

Nazario Moreno Gonzalez, alias "El Chayo,” was a founding member of the Familia Michoacana and was killed in 2014.
